Australian beauty brand Vida Glow launches new campaign via UM

Ingestible beauty brand Vida Glow has launched a new campaign to promote its biggest seller, Vida Glow Marine Collagen.

The global brand campaign includes a 30-second TVC alongside imagery that will have a global reach via catch-up TV, print, digital, and OOH. The campaign was shot by Australian photographers Ben Morris and Derek Henderson during the pandemic.

Vida Glow founder Anna Lahey told Mumbrella: “The nutricosmetics market is booming, and it is predicted this growth will continue its momentum over the next decade. The collagen category alone is expected to grow to over $6.5 billion by 2025. It’s a busy space, which is why we’re so adamant about setting the industry standard – moving first, innovating and pushing the boundaries of what’s possible in ingestible beauty. And our global campaign is a perfect reflection of that.”

Vida Glow creative director, Rachel Dawson, added: “The campaign was an intentional deviation from advertising commonly seen in the wellness industry. Vida Glow presents a unique perspective for the ingestible category and the creative direction needed to be emblematic of that. Dynamic and representative of how we want to show up in the world: bold, disruptive and bursting with energy.”

This year, the brand has expanded to key countries, including the UK, Germany, and a US launch last week in LA. Vida Glow also opened a permanent store at Sydney Airport in line with the return of international travel.
